  2. 5 Νοε 2011 · The canonical T-SQL (SqlServer) answer is to use a DELETE with JOIN as such. DELETE o. FROM Orders o. INNER JOIN Customers c. ON o.CustomerId = c.CustomerId. WHERE c.FirstName = 'sklivvz'. This will delete all orders which have a customer with first name Sklivvz. edited Nov 19, 2012 at 9:59.

  7. 10 Σεπ 2016 · Another way is using CTE: ;WITH cte AS (SELECT * FROM workrecord2 w WHERE EXISTS (SELECT 1 FROM employee e WHERE employeerun = employeeno AND company = '1' AND date = '2013-05-06')) DELETE FROM cte. Note: We cannot use JOIN inside CTE when you want to delete. edited Jan 16, 2021 at 1:24. Peter Mortensen.

You can do this with SQL Server Management Studio. → Right click the table design and go to Relationships and choose the foreign key on the left-side pane and in the right-side pane, expand the menu "INSERT and UPDATE specification" and select "Cascade" as Delete Rule. edited Nov 12, 2014 at 20:39. senshin.
